Trinks Inc. operates as a specialized manufacturer of custom hydraulic presses and advanced plastic processing equipment. With a heritage spanning nearly one hundred years, the company has cultivated deep technical expertise in the design and fabrication of precision-engineered machinery, including plasticators and extruders. Their market position is defined by a commitment to durability and innovation, serving a diverse client base that includes the automotive, medical, and marine sectors. How much funding has Trinks raised?

Trinks has raised a total of $853K across 2 funding rounds:

2020

Debt

$350K

2021

Debt

$503K

Debt (2020): $350K with participation from PPP

Debt (2021): $503K led by PPP
